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

The disclosed embodiments include computer-implemented apparatuses and processes that provision, in real-time, targeted digital content based on decomposed, structured messaging data. For example, an apparatus may receive a message associated with an exchange of data involving a first counterparty and a second counterparty. The message includes elements of message data disposed within corresponding message fields, and the message data characterizes a real-time payment requested from the second counterparty by the first counterparty. The apparatus may generate intent data associated with the data exchange based on the elements of the message data, and based on the intent data, obtain digital content associated with the data exchange. The apparatus may transmit notification data that includes the digital content to a device operable by the second counterparty, and an application program executed at the device to may present a portion of the digital content within a digital interface.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

What is claimed is: 1 . An apparatus comprising: a communications interface; a memory storing instructions; and at least one processor coupled to the communications interface and to the memory, the at least one processor being configured to execute the instructions to: receive, via the communications interface, a message associated with an exchange of data involving a first counterparty and a second counterparty, the message comprising elements of message data disposed within corresponding message fields, and the message data characterizing a real-time payment requested from the second counterparty by the first counterparty; generate intent data associated with the data exchange based on the elements of the message data, and based on the intent data, obtain digital content associated with the data exchange; and transmit, via the communications interface, notification data that includes the digital content to a device operable by the second counterparty, the notification data causing an application program executed at the device to present a portion of the digital content within a digital interface. 2 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to execute the instructions to: obtain, from the memory, mapping data associated with the message fields of the received message; perform operations that obtain the elements of the message data from corresponding ones of the message fields based on the mapping data; and store the elements of the message data within the memory, the elements of the message data comprising a first identifier of the first counterparty, a second identifier of the second counterparty, and a parameter value characterizing the data exchange. 3 . The apparatus of claim 2 , wherein: the received message comprises a request-for-payment message, the message fields of the request-for-payment message being structured in accordance with a standardized data-exchange protocol; and elements of the mapping data identify corresponding ones of the elements of the message data and corresponding ones of the message fields. 4 . The apparatus of claim 2 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to execute the instructions to obtain, based on the mapping data, remittance information associated with the data exchange from one or more of the message fields, the remittance information comprising a uniform resource locator associated with one or more elements of formatted data maintained by a computing system. 5 . The apparatus of claim 4 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to execute the instructions to extract at least one of the first identifier, the second identifier, or an additional parameter value characterizing the data exchange from corresponding portions of the uniform resource locator. 6 . The apparatus of claim 4 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to execute the instructions to, based on the uniform resource locator, perform operations that request and receive the one or more elements of the formatted data from the computing system via the communications interface. 7 . The apparatus of claim 6 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to execute the instructions to process the one or more elements of formatted data, and obtain at least one of the first identifier, the second identifier, or an additional parameter value characterizing the data exchange from the processed elements of formatted data. 8 . The apparatus of claim 6 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to execute the instructions to: process the one or more elements of the formatted data, and obtain one or more elements of contextual data that characterize the data exchange based on the processed elements of formatted data; and generate the intent data associated with the data exchange based on portions of the elements of the message data and the contextual data. 9 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to generate the intent data based on an application of a trained machine learning or artificial intelligence process to the elements of the message data. 10 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ein: the obtained digital content is associated with at least one of a product or service available to the second counterparty; and wherein the at least one processor is further configured to execute the instructions to: receive, via the communications interface, a response to the notification data from the device; based on the response, perform operations that provision the at least one product or service to the second counterparty; and store data associated with the at least one provisioned product or service within the memory. 11 . A computer-implemented method, comprising: receiving, using at least one processor, a message associated with an exchange of data involving a first counterparty and a second counterparty, the message comprising elements of message data disposed within corresponding message fields, and the message data characterizing a real-time payment requested from the second counterparty by the first counterparty; using the at least one processor, generating intent data associated with the data exchange based on the elements of the message data, and based on the intent data, obtaining digital content associated with the data exchange; and transmitting, using the at least one processor, notification data that includes the digital content to a device operable by the second counterparty, the notification data causing an application program executed at the device to present a portion of the digital content within a digital interface. 12 . The computer-implemented method of claim 11 , further comprising: obtaining, using the at least one processor, mapping data associated with the message fields of the received message; performing operations, using the at least one processor, that obtain the elements of the message data from corresponding ones of the message fields based on the mapping data; and storing, using the at least one processor, the elements of the message data within a data repository, the elements of the message data comprising a first identifier of the first counterparty, a second identifier of the second counterparty, and a parameter value characterizing the data exchange. 13 . The computer-implemented method of claim 12 , wherein: the received message comprises a request-for-payment message, the message fields of the request-for-payment message being structured in accordance with a standardized data-exchange protocol; and elements of the mapping data identify corresponding ones of the elements of the message data and corresponding ones of the message fields. 14 . The computer-implemented method of claim 12 , further comprising obtaining, using the at least one processor, remittance information associated with the data exchange from one or more of the message fields based on the mapping data, the remittance information comprising a uniform resource locator associated with one or more elements of formatted data maintained by a computing system. 15 . The computer-implemented method of claim 14 , further comprising performing operations, using the at least one processor, that extract at least one of the first identifier, the second identifier, or an additional parameter value characterizing the data exchange from corresponding portions of the uniform resource locator. 16 .
